I would love to support you on your journey of self-discovery. I tailor my therapeutic approach to each client’s personality, history, and goals. Art therapy is the primary modality I use. It can feel intimidating at first, but I do my best to create a safe, supportive environment where you can gently explore therapeutic art-making. Art-making is nervous system work — it helps expand our capacity to experience and process a wide range of emotions.
I also draw from a variety of evidence-based approaches, including Internal Family Systems (IFS),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), and Dialectical Behaviour Therapy (DBT). Somatic-based therapies are central to my work as well. For clients who are interested, I incorporate meditation, breathwork, and other somatic practices into sessions.
